    Information flows faster than ever before. From IoT devices and autonomous systems to industrial sensors and digital services, organizations generate massive amounts of data every second. While this influx of information opens the door to new possibilities, it also presents a serious challenge: how do we manage, analyze, and act on all this data without being buried by it? Edge intelligence may hold the key to navigating this digital avalanche.

    Centralized Processing Isn’t Scalable Anymore

    Traditional systems have long relied on centralized data centers or cloud platforms for

    processing. In this model, raw data is sent from endpoints to the cloud, analyzed, and then returned to the device or user as insights. This approach works for many use cases, but its limitations become evident in real-time applications where speed, autonomy, and bandwidth are critical.

    Industries like healthcare, manufacturing, and logistics can’t afford the delays associated with cloud-based analysis. Even milliseconds of latency can hinder timely decisions. In addition, there is an exponential growth in data volumes, and it becomes  clear that centralized processing alone can no longer keep up.

    What Is Edge Intelligence?

    Edge intelligence refers to deploying artificial intelligence (AI) and machine learning (ML) capabilities directly on edge devices—those closest to the data source. Rather than relying on distant cloud servers, these devices process data locally, enabling faster response times and reduced network strain.

    By integrating AI at the edge, systems can act autonomously. This local processing

    transforms devices from passive data collectors into active decision-makers. The result is a smarter, more efficient system that can keep up with the pace and complexity of modern operations.

    Tackling Information Overload

    So, how exactly does edge intelligence help manage the problem of information overload?1. 2. 3. 4. 5. Localized Decision-Making: Edge intelligence allows devices to analyze and respond to data in real-time without waiting for cloud approval. This reduces data bottlenecks and ensures faster, context-aware decisions.

    Data Prioritization and Filtering: Edge devices can filter out redundant or irrelevant information instead of transmitting all data to a central location. Only the most valuable insights are sent upstream for storage or further analysis.

    Bandwidth Optimization: By processing data locally, systems reduce their reliance on internet connectivity and minimize the data that must be transmitted. This is crucial for remote locations or operations that demand real-time performance.

    Enhanced Security and Compliance: Keeping sensitive data closer to its source enhances privacy and compliance. Edge devices can anonymize or encrypt data before it ever leaves the premises.

    The Role of the In-Memory Database

    As edge systems become more autonomous faster, temporary data storage becomes crucial. This is where the in-memory database comes into play. Unlike traditional disk- based databases, an in-memory database stores data in the system’s main memory (RAM), enabling ultra-fast processing.

    When paired with edge computing, an in-memory database supports lightning-quick decision-making, especially in high-frequency environments like financial trading, industrial automation, or smart cities. It ensures that critical data can be accessed and acted upon without delay, keeping operations running smoothly despite massive data influx.
